I'm My! Strawberry Egg - A world where youth and cross-dressing intersectThe TV anime series "I'm My! Strawberry Egg" aired in 2001 and is still loved by many fans for its unique setting and the characters' youthful lives. This anime is an original work, with the original story by YOM. It aired on WOWOW from July 4th to September 26th, 2001, with a total of 13 episodes. It was produced by TNK and directed by Yamaguchi Yuji. storyThe story begins with Tenka Hibiki, a young man aspiring to be a teacher, seeking employment at Seito Sannomiya Junior High School, where there is a strong female superiority-male inferiority culture. However, the principal of the school tells him, "Our school only hires female teachers," and Hibiki is at a loss. However, with the help of his landlady, Grandma Ruru, he disguises himself as a woman and infiltrates the school as "Tenka Hibiki." This single word, "It's okay!", marks the beginning of a youthful lesson between Hibiki and the second-year junior high school girls. The story depicts Hibiki's growth through his interactions with his students while working as a teacher cross-dressed, as well as the struggles and joys he faces in the special situation of cross-dressing. In particular, the story highlights a realistic side of youth by depicting the emotional growth and worries of the students as Hibiki interacts with them as "Hibiki-sensei." castThe cast of this work is diverse, with Kishi Yuji and Masuda Yuki playing the main character, Hibiki Amano, and the characters around Hibiki are also played by voice actors with rich personalities. In particular, the performances of Watanabe Akino as Kuzuha Kaedeko, Takahashi Mikako as Himejima Fujio, and Orikasa Fumiko as Kasugano Michiko stand out, bringing out the charm of each character. Additionally, many of the residents of Gochi-so are unique characters, and the performances of veteran voice actors such as Kujira and Ueda Yuji add depth to the work. Main StaffThe staff is also impressive, including director Yamaguchi Yuji, series composer Kobayashi Yasuko, and character designer Fujii Maki. In particular, the music by Nishida Masala is an important element in enhancing the atmosphere of the work. In addition, the visuals are also of high quality, with art director Kono Jiro and color designer Kobayashi Miyoko. Main CharactersThe students at Seito Sannomiya Junior High School are all unique characters. Kuzuha Kaedeko lost her mother at a young age and her father is currently working overseas, but she is portrayed as living a positive life. Himejima Fujio is a good friend of Kaedeko's and is an active character who is a member of the softball club but also practices aikido. Kasugano Michiko is an elegant girl of noble blood, and her low tolerance for men is an interesting setting. Umeda Miho stands out from the other students in her class because she has a boyfriend. The residents of Gochi-so are also unique, especially the landlord, Sanjo Ruru, who is a doctor of engineering but also has a diverse background as the head of the Chaka school and the original beauty pageant queen. Hibiki's pet dog, Kura, also has a unique name and background, adding color to the story. subtitleMany of the subtitles for each episode are related to cosmetics, and symbolize the theme and development of the story. For example, some of the titles reflect the setting of Hibiki cross-dressing, such as "First Lipstick in a Dangerous State" and "Forbidden, Barely Legal Eyeliner." Others evoke the bittersweetness of youth, such as "Sexy Gloss for Midsummer Nights" and "Fragrance Heart for Adults." Theme songs and musicThe opening theme "Dearest" is sung by Mieno Hitomi, with lyrics and music by Sawada Seiko and arrangement by Nishida Masala. This song features a beautiful melody and lyrics that symbolize Hibiki's feelings and the theme of the story. The ending theme "WHITE STATION" is sung by Ace File (Yoshikawa Maye, Kushi Marina, Kudo Asagi, Nara Saori), with lyrics by Yoshii Rei, and music and arrangement by Nishida Masala.
